A 50 mL crude extract of skeletal muscle contains 32 mg of protein per mL. Ten microliter of the extract catalyzes a reaction at a rate of 0.14 micromol product formed per minute. The extract was frationated by ammonium sulfate precipitation, and the fraction precipitating between 20% and 40% saturation was redissolved in 10 mL. This soluction contains 50 mg/mL protein. Ten microliters of this purified faction catalyzes the reation at a rate of 0.65 micromol/min.
a) what is the degree of purification (fold purification)?
b) what is the percent yield of the enzyme recovered in the purified fraction?
